Output 04c8dab5a89d7005c81d3c7868bae45ab2138a047ea718bd699d7d8767836183:13

value
1026280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ef66186c61c074eb993a01bf7ae0a92eab45e038 OP_EQUAL
address
3PWqj6zv3stbC8vVLymDst6Af9dMw2SVoD
transaction
04c8dab5a89d7005c81d3c7868bae45ab2138a047ea718bd699d7d8767836183
spent
true